The History of Slot Machines
Slot machines first appeared in the late 19th century, with the Liberty Bell being one of the first successful designs. As technology progressed, so did slot machines, transitioning from mechanical designs to electric and now digital formats. These changes not only improved the game's accessibility but also its appeal with elaborate themes and graphics. Today, players have access to thousands of different slot games worldwide, all thanks to the creative developments in the industry.

The Role of RNG in Game Fairness
The fairness of slot games relies heavily on Random Number Generators (RNGs). These algorithms ensure that each spin is unpredictable and that the game operates fairly. In 2026, the importance of transparency in RNG functioning continues to grow, leading to improved player trust. Regulatory bodies scrutinize these systems to guarantee that players are receiving a fair gaming experience.

Progressive Jackpots Explained
Progressive jackpots are perhaps the most enticing feature of modern slots, where a small percentage of each bet contributes to a jackpot that continues to grow until won. These jackpots can reach life-changing amounts, making them an attractive aspect for players. It is vital for players to understand the mechanics behind progressive bets and the house edge involved to strategize effectively.

Understanding Slot Game Volatility
Slot game volatility refers to the risk associated with each game. High-volatility slots may offer larger payouts but less frequent wins, while low-volatility slots provide smaller wins more regularly. Players should assess their risk tolerance level when selecting games to ensure a comfortable gaming experience.
Leveraging RTP for Better Odds
Understanding the RTP of a slot machine can give players an edge. RTP is a theoretical measure of how much money a game will pay back to players over time. Slots with higher RTP percentages tend to yield better long-term returns, making them a preferred choice for strategic players.

Recognizing Signs of Problem Gambling
Being aware of the signs of problem gambling is crucial. Symptoms may include increased time spent gambling, wagering more than intended, or experiencing stress due to gambling-related expenses. Awareness can prompt seeking help before the behavior escalates.
Setting Limits and Managing Time
A successful gambling experience relies on setting clear limits regarding time and money. Players should pre-determine how much they are willing to spend and how long they plan to play. Additionally, utilizing tools like self-exclusion options can provide more control over gambling habits.
